resident Joko “Jokowi” Widodo has pledged to produce policies that protect human rights and the environment, noting that speed and accuracy should not be exchanged for “carelessness and arbitrariness”.

Dressed in traditional Sabu attire from East Nusa Tenggara, the President delivered the speech during an annual state of the nation address before members of the country’s executive, legislative and judicial branches at the House of Representatives compound in Senayan, Central Jakarta, on Friday.

He said a high degree of flexibility and a streamlined bureaucracy should never be achieved by sacrificing legal certainty, anticorruption efforts and democracy.

“All policies must focus on environmental friendliness and promote the protection of human rights,” he said.

Jokowi went on to say that the government had always made serious efforts at corruption eradication and added that measures to prevent corruption had to be intensified through simple, transparent and efficient governance.

“The law must be enforced without discrimination. The upholding of democratic values cannot be compromised. Democracy must continue without disrupting the speed of work and legal certainty, as well as the noble values of our nation,” he said.

With his speech, Jokowi appeared to respond to criticism over how his government has pressed ahead with the deliberation of controversial bills, including the omnibus bill on jobs.
